The Mason Center for Social Entrepreneurship identifies, prepares, and empowers the next generation of social entrepreneurs. Our role is to: - Leverage the formative years of the university experience to connect emerging social entrepreneurs to one another and to their peers at other institutions and organizations; Inspire student leaders-- from every discipline of study and career path-- to channel their talents and passions into the work of social entrepreneurship; - Create and nurture intensive, cohort-based, cross-disciplinary educational spaces that link theory and research with practical and applied learning that benefits real people in real communities; - Mobilize a vital network of mentors, role models, educators and current social entrepreneurs from all sectors to support and extend the work of future social entrepreneurs; and, - Connect emerging social entrepreneurs to their communities of interest and/or their communities of origin in mutually beneficial and sustainable ways.
